当前位置: 首页 >  帮助中心  > 开发者利器:v130版本新增WebGPU支持实战教学

开发者利器:v130版本新增WebGPU支持实战教学

发布时间:2025-05-13
详情介绍

开发者利器:v130版本新增WebGPU支持实战教学1

在v130版本中,WebGPU支持的加入为开发者提供了更强大的图形计算能力。以下是实战教学中的关键步骤。首先,确保开发环境已更新至支持WebGPU的版本,并安装必要的开发工具和驱动。
接下来,创建一个简单的WebGPU项目。使用HTML和JavaScript编写基础代码,引入WebGPU相关API。通过调用`navigator.gpu`获取GPU设备,并配置渲染管线和着色器。这些操作可以确保你能够通过WebGPU API初始化图形计算资源,避免因配置不当导致的性能瓶颈问题。
然后,编写WebGPU着色器代码。使用WGSL(WebGPU Shading Language)编写顶点和片段着色器,定义图形渲染的逻辑。将着色器代码集成到项目中,并通过WebGPU API将其加载到GPU设备中。这些操作可以确保你能够通过编写着色器实现自定义图形效果,避免因代码错误导致的渲染失败问题。
接下来,优化WebGPU性能。通过合理分配GPU资源、减少不必要的计算和数据传输,提升渲染效率。使用WebGPU提供的调试工具,分析性能瓶颈并进行针对性优化。这些操作可以确保你能够通过性能优化提升图形渲染速度,避免因资源浪费导致的帧率下降问题。
最后,测试和部署WebGPU应用。在不同设备和浏览器上进行兼容性测试,确保应用在各种环境下都能正常运行。将优化后的项目部署到生产环境,供用户使用。这些操作可以确保你能够通过全面测试保证应用稳定性,避免因兼容性问题导致的用户体验下降问题。
通过以上步骤,你可以充分利用v130版本新增的WebGPU支持,开发高性能的图形应用,提升开发效率和用户体验。
继续阅读
猜你喜欢
回到顶部